Tell us, how did you start surfing?
When I was younger, I was unable to stand still… Football, tennis, bike, hiking, handball… I practiced a lot of sports and I only played with boys. Living at the seaside, I used to go to the beach very often during summer. I played with a bodyboard in the waves and with my friends we tried to stand up on. Naturally, we wanted to try surfing and I started at the age of 8.
What are your future plans and ambitions?
Currently, I’m seeking to two main objectives in comps: get back on the WCT and earn a pass for the 2020 Olympics. I also hope to do some nice trips between two deadlines. I love the original destinations that we do not expect to surf…
What are your best surfing memories?
It’s hard to choose… My ISA Junior World Champion title in 2006 was a magical moment. Everything went as in my dreams. There is also my first tube during a surf trip in Mentawaii Islands. Two very different memories but both strongs.
